svg2rlg is a python tool to convert SVG files to reportlab graphics. The tool can be used as a console application to convert SVG to PDF files. Known problems ( AKA todo list): Missing support for elliptical arcs in paths. It is belived to be possible to convert arcs to quadratic beziers. Text handling is limited. Style sheets not supported. Note that some limitations are due to limitation in the reportlab graphics package: No gradients No text on path No filling rules (only odd-even) A wxpython tool is included in the distribution which does a side by side comparison to the SVG test suite. Presently most of the official SVG 1.1 test suite is prefect.
